Once youve filed away the top layer of polish put your fingers in a shallow bowl of warm pure acetone. Using either an electric file or a really good nail file to buff away the acrylic. Once the acrylic has softened take your cuticle pusher or orange stick and carefully push the acrylic off your nail starting from the cuticle area to the free edge.
